Prevent witness tampering: DMK to SC appointed Karur Panel

Chennai: DMK on Thursday petitioned a Supreme Court-appointed supervisory committee to ensure that Tamil Nadu CM C Joseph Vijay's scheduled visit to Karur does not influence material witnesses in the ongoing CBI probe into the 2025 stampede case. Vijay is slated to travel to Karur on July 10 to meet the families of the deceased and injured victims of the stampede to hand over government orders for compassionate appointments.

In a formal representation, DMK's organisation secretary RS Bharathi requested the panel to issue directions to the chief secretary and CBI to take adequate measures safeguarding the witnesses from tampering or influence.
